package org.apache.activemq.broker.region.policy;

import java.util.List;
import org.apache.activemq.broker.region.MessageReference;
import org.apache.activemq.broker.region.Subscription;
import org.apache.activemq.filter.MessageEvaluationContext;

/**
 * Simple dispatch policy that sends a message to every subscription that
 * matches the message.
 * 
 * @org.apache.xbean.XBean
 * 
 */
public class SimpleDispatchPolicy implements DispatchPolicy {

    public boolean dispatch(MessageReference node, MessageEvaluationContext msgContext, List<Subscription> consumers)
            throws Exception {

        int count = 0;
        for (Subscription sub : consumers) {
            // Don't deliver to browsers
            if (sub.getConsumerInfo().isBrowser()) {
                continue;
            }
            // Only dispatch to interested subscriptions
            if (!sub.matches(node, msgContext)) {
                sub.unmatched(node);
                continue;
            }

            sub.add(node);
            count++;
        }

        return count > 0;
    }

}
